Kornuth Wins Wynn Summer Classic $3,500 NLH for $353,891; Glaser & Levy Nabs Titles

2021 Wynn Summer Classic winners

The 2021 Wynn Summer Classic, which began on May 27 and ran through July 13, was comprised of more than 30 events that offered over $16 million in guarantees. That included the highly successful $10,000 buy-in, $10,000,000 GTD Wynn Millions won by Andrew Moreno for $1.4 million and the $1,600 buy-in, $1.5 million GTD Mystery Bounty won by Uri Reichenstein.

“We couldn’t have asked for a better Summer Classic, and I certainly didn’t anticipate the fanfare created by the one-two punch of the Wynn Millions and Mystery Bounty,” Wynn Director of Poker Operations Ryan Beauregard told PokerNews. “It was fun to showcase the Wynn poker brand to such a large audience, and I’m confident that the Wynn Millions has a bright future.”

Chance Kornuth Wins $3,500 NLH for $353,891

The last big tournament of the 2021 Wynn Summer Classic was the $3,500 buy-in, $1,000,000 GTD No-Limit Hold’em tournament, which attracted 530 runners and offered up a $1,711,900 prize pool.

The top 53 players made the money including Tomas Soderstrom (10th - $29,787), Joey Weissman (12th - $25,593), Alex Rocha (14th - $22,135), Thomas Boivin (20th - $16,737), Kristen Bicknell (25th - $12,733), former Wynn Winter Classic champ Michael Rocco (27th - $12,733), Ryan Laplante (37th - $9,712), Michael “The Grinder” Mizrachi (38th - $9,712), and Nate Silver (40th - $9,712).

The final table was a stacked affair that included Justin Saliba, who recently captured his first WSOP gold bracelet, WPT champ Bobby Oboodi, and reigning WPT Player of the Year Brian Altman. However, it was a familiar face coming out on top as poker pro Chance Kornuth, who back in June won the MSPT Venetian for $412,086, laid claim to the title and $353,891 first-place prize.

Benny Glaser Wins 3,000 PLO Event for $102K

While the Wynn Millions was nearing its end, the $3,000 buy-in, $100K GTD Pot-Limit Omaha event was playing out. That tournament attracted 146 runners and crushed the guarantee by offering up a $407,340 prize pool.

In the end, it was the UK's Benny Glaser, a three-time World Series of Poker (WSOP) bracelet winner, who collected every chip in play to capture the first-place $70,641 payday.

Allan Le a PLO Bounty Hunter

The $1,600 buy-in, Pot-Limit Omaha $500 Bounty tournament drew 123 entrants and offered up a $117,465 prize pool. The top 13 finishers got paid and among those to cash but fall short of the final table were Damjan Radanov (10th - $2,948), Ben Primus (11th - $2,948), Javier Zarco (12th - $2,572), and Ryan Tosoc (13th - $2,572).

A heads-up deal was struck and the tournament ultimately ended with Jesse Lonis finishing as runner-up for $28,159 while Allan Le of Huntington Beach, California took the trophy and $30,583 in prize money.

Simon Levy Closes Out Series

The 2021 Wynn Summer Classic ended with a $500 buy-in, $500K GTD No-Limit Hold’em event that drew 2,480 and more than doubled the guarantee by generating a $1,054,000 prize pool.

That was paid out to the top 269 finishers and among those to make deep run were Jared Jaffee (9th - $15,047), Ben Underwood (10th - $12,780), Terry Fleischer (20th - $6,994), Katrina Weaver (28th - $4,550), and Michael Lech (37th - $3,972).

The title came down to a pair of players from Washington, and in the end, it was Bellevue’s Simon Levy besting Seattle’s Matthew Jewett in the heads-up play to win the title and $92,147 first-place prize.
